What the bond and insurance requirements mean for homeowners

Washington requires specialty contractors to file a $15,000 surety bond with the Department of Labor & Industries as a condition of registration ($30,000 for general contractors). This contractor's current filing shows a $15,000 bond.

The bond is a limited fund a homeowner (or subcontractor or supplier) can make a claim against, through the courts, if a registered contractor fails to meet its obligations on a job. Contractors must also keep general liability insurance on file — at least $50,000 in property damage and $200,000 in public liability coverage, or a $250,000 combined single limit — which covers damage the contractor causes, not workmanship disputes. The rows above are the bond and insurance filings L&I publishes for this registration; whether a specific filing applies to a specific project depends on its dates and terms.

What is a Dry Wall contractor licensed to do in Washington?

A drywall specialty contractor is registered with WA L&I to hang, tape, and finish gypsum wallboard. The registration is limited to drywall work. The registration requires a $15,000 surety bond and general liability insurance on file with WA L&I. Washington currently lists 49 Dry Wall contractors registered in Spokane.
